it doesn’t seem that very many folks are as meticulous as us.

And there's the rub. The Black Ark is used in different ways. Some people burnish the surface to round/smooth the novaculite there. Some use a flattening plate (or SiC powder) on the surface to create surface texture. I'm in the second camp. In neither case does the stone remove much material from a razor. Mostly, its scratch pattern creates a texture on the apex just like other finishing stones do. The Ark texture is finer than a coticule and not as even as the texture from a synthetic. To me, its feel is somewhere between a synthetic and a coticule. I haven't done this, but I've been told that if you really push the edge on an Ark its appearance under the scope will be bad, but the feel will be amazing. I haven't tried this yet, but I think that the edge will be quite fragile.
